Are there any assisted living facilities directly in Hancocks Bridge, NJ?
Hancocks Bridge is a very small, rural community, and there are no dedicated assisted living facilities within its immediate boundaries. However, residents typically access assisted living options in nearby cities such as Salem, Pennsville, or even Carneys Point, which are within a short driving distance. These facilities offer the necessary care while allowing seniors to remain close to the Hancocks Bridge area.

How are assisted living facilities regulated in New Jersey, and what should I look for when choosing one near Hancocks Bridge?
Assisted living facilities in New Jersey are licensed and regulated by the New Jersey Department of Health under the Assisted Living Residence regulations. When choosing a facility near Hancocks Bridge, ensure it has a valid state license, check for any recent inspection reports or violations, and verify that staff are properly trained and background-checked. It's also advisable to visit facilities in person and ask about their emergency procedures, especially given the rural setting of Hancocks Bridge and potential for weather-related issues.
What local resources are available to help seniors and families with assisted living decisions in the Hancocks Bridge, NJ area?
Seniors and families in Hancocks Bridge can access resources through the Salem County Office on Aging & Disabled, which provides information, referrals, and support services. Additionally, the New Jersey Department of Human Services' Division of Aging Services offers programs like the State Health Insurance Assistance Program (SHIP) for Medicare counseling. Local senior centers in Salem and other nearby towns may also offer guidance and social opportunities to help with the transition to assisted living.
